How they compare
Barbados currently reports 7.4% against 7.0% in Cook Islands, a difference of 0.3%.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 54 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Cook Islands ahead.
Barbados ranks 187th and Cook Islands ranks 188th of 204 countries.

About this data
Nitrogen use efficiency (NUE) is the ratio between nitrogen inputs and output. A NUE of 40% means that only 40% of nitrogen inputs are converted into nitrogen in the form of crops.
